“…Systemic therapy with teriparatide has been shown to improve healing in preclinical fracture models [1,20,28,32], in clinical studies of wrist fractures [2], and in case reports [8,19,31,33,37,38]. However, the results from these pooled trials revealed no treatment effect of teriparatide versus placebo in the rates of revision surgery or radiographic fracture healing in femoral neck fractures.…”

“…Estrogen has been demonstrated to have diverse effects on bone healing in Ovx rats. Whereas Stuermer et al (2010) reported improved callus and bone parameters after estrogen supplementation, Jahng & Kim (2000) and Komrakova et al (2010) found no advantage of estrogen treatment for fracture healing. In this study, despite anti-catabolic stimulus, estrogen treatment in Ovx rats impeded healing processes.…”

“…Several studies have reported that intermittent administration of human PTH also enhances fracture healing of cortical bones such as the shaft of the femur or tibia after surgical intervention in animals (Andeassen et al 1999;Holzer et al 1999;Nakazawa et al 2005), even in an osteoporotic animal model (Jahng and Kim 2000). However, very few studies have addressed fracture healing of cancellous bones, which are frequent fracture sites in osteoporosis patients, after injury or surgical intervention (Komrakova et al 2010). Therefore, a cancellous bone fracture model was created and an osteotomy of the proximal tibia was performed.…”
